First things first: there's no single answer to "How much Dogecoin is that TikTok dog gift?" The value is entirely dependent on a few key factors: the specific gift itself (some are more expensive than others), the current Dogecoin price (which, let's face it, is famously volatile!), and the platform facilitating the transaction. TikTok doesn't directly support Dogecoin transactions in the same way it handles traditional currency. Instead, any Dogecoin-based gifting would likely involve a third-party service or a clever workaround by the content creator.

Let's imagine a scenario. A popular dog influencer on TikTok is receiving virtual gifts from their dedicated fanbase. These gifts might be themed around Dogecoin, perhaps featuring Shiba Inus or Doge-related imagery. The creator might have a system set up where viewers can donate a certain amount of fiat currency (like US dollars) which is then converted into Dogecoin. The amount of Dogecoin they receive would then depend on the exchange rate at that precise moment. This is where things get interesting, because Dogecoin's price can swing wildly in short periods. A gift worth $10 might buy a significantly different amount of Dogecoin one day compared to the next.

This inherent volatility is both a blessing and a curse for Dogecoin gifting. On the one hand, it adds a layer of excitement and unpredictability. Receiving a "Doge gift" could be seen as a speculative investment in itself, as the value of the received Dogecoin could increase or decrease after the transaction. On the other hand, this volatility introduces a level of uncertainty. The value of the gift might not be what the sender or receiver initially anticipated, especially if the price experiences a dramatic shift.

Another crucial aspect is the platform used to handle these Dogecoin transactions. Many platforms charge transaction fees, which can eat into the value of the gift. Therefore, even if a user sends a seemingly substantial amount of Dogecoin, the creator might receive a smaller amount after fees are deducted. This is something to bear in mind when considering the true value of a Dogecoin-themed virtual gift.
